The OVERINVESTED Trap
Ever felt so wrapped up in a project that criticism feels like a personal attack? That’s the classic OVERINVESTED pattern – you become over‑committed to an idea, letting emotions hijack objectivity. The result? Heightened stress, blurred decision‑making, and a fragile self‑esteem that wobbles at every comment.
Introducing the Balanced Engagement Method
What if you could keep the passion that fuels great work without the burnout? Meet the Balanced Engagement Method – a simple, three‑step practice that redirects OVERINVESTED energy into healthy focus: 1. Pause & Label – When you notice a surge of attachment, pause for 30 seconds and label the feeling (e.g., “I’m feeling OVERINVESTED”). 2. Re‑frame the Goal – Shift from personal validation to collective impact. Write a one‑sentence purpose that serves the team, not just your ego. 3. Scheduled Detachment – Allocate a daily “unplug” window (15‑20 minutes) where you deliberately step away from the task, practicing mindfulness or a brief walk.

Practical Tips to Keep the Balance
Bullet‑proof boundaries: Set clear start‑and‑stop times for deep work. - Micro‑celebrations: Acknowledge progress without tying it to self‑worth. - Accountability buddy: Share your OVERINVESTED moments and let a trusted colleague remind you of the re‑frame.
Homework: The 2‑Day Reset
For the next two days, log each time you catch yourself feeling OVERINVESTED. Apply the three steps, then note the change in stress level on a 1‑10 scale. Share your findings in the comments – transformation is contagious!
